Victor Osimhen will lead the Super Eagles as captain in their semi-final clash against Morocco’s Atlas Lions at the 2025 Africa Cup of Nations (AFCON)
Regular captain Wilfred Ndidi will miss the game after picking up a suspension due to card accumulation.
Ndidi received his first booking in Nigeria’s Round of 16 victory over Mozambique and was cautioned again in the quarter-final against Tunisia.
Osimhen, who was appointed vice-captain ahead of the tournament, previously wore the armband in Nigeria’s final group-stage match against Uganda.
The striker’s leadership is expected to be crucial as the Super Eagles aim to secure a spot in the AFCON final, building on a strong campaign so far.
